Description

A nanny is employed by a family in either a live-in or live-out basis. The function of a nanny is to essentially be responsible for all care of the children in the home in a largely unsupervised setting. Duties are typically focused on childcare and any household chores or tasks related to the children. A nanny may or may not have any formal training; however, many have significant actual experience. A nanny typically works full-time of at least 40 hours a week.
The employing parents are generally responsible for withholding and paying federal income taxes, Social Security tax, and Medicare as well as state income taxes (in most states).

Generally, an Arlington Texas Nanny Contract does not need to be notarized to be valid. However, having it notarized can add a layer of professionalism and security. It may also be beneficial if you want to establish a formal agreement that both parties can rely on in the case of disputes.

To write up an Arlington Texas Nanny Contract, start by clearly stating the names of both parties involved. Include essential details such as job responsibilities, work hours, payment terms, and vacation policies. It is important to specify any additional duties, like light housekeeping or meal preparation, to avoid misunderstandings later.
